# The two main "package management" systems for MacOS are Homebrew (https://brew.sh/), which provides the
# `brew` command, and MacPorts (https://ports.macports.org/), which provides the `port` command. They work in
# different ways, and have different philosophies. Homebrew distributes binaries and MacPorts (mostly) builds
# everything from source. MacPorts installs for all users and requires sudo. Homebrew installs only for the
# current user and does not require sudo. This means they install things to different locations:
# - Homebrew packages are installed under /usr/local/Cellar/ with symlinks in /usr/local/opt/
# - MacPorts packages are installed under /opt/local
# Note too that package names can vary slightly between HomeBrew and MacPorts.
#
# We install most of the Mac dependencies via Homebrew using the `brew` command below. However, as at
# 2023-12-01, Homebrew has stopped supplying a package for Xalan-C. So, we install that using MacPorts, which
# provides the `port` command.
# Unfortunately, the different approaches mean there are limits on the extent to which you can mix-and-match
# between the two systems.
#
# Note that MacPorts (port) requires sudo but Homebrew (brew) does not. Perhaps more importantly, they two
# package managers install things to different locations:
# - Homebrew packages are installed under /usr/local/Cellar/ with symlinks in /usr/local/opt/
# - MacPorts packages are installed under /opt/local
# This means we need to have both directories in the include path when we come to compile. On the whole, both
# CMake and Meson take care of finding a library automatically once given its name.
# In the past, we installed everything via Homebrew as it was very quick and seemed to work, provided we had
# both directories in the include path when we came to compile (because CMake and Meson can generally take care
# of finding a library automatically once given its name).
#
# Note too that package names vary slightly between HomeBrew and MacPorts. Don't assume you can always guess
# one from the other, as it's occasionally not evident.
# However, as at 2023-12-01, Homebrew has stopped supplying a package for Xalan-C. So, we started installing
# Xalan and Xerces using MacPorts, whilst still installing everything else via Homebrew. This seemed to work
# for a while, but in 2024, after upgrading to Qt6, we started having problems with the Qt `macdeployqt`
# command (which is used to pull all the necessary Qt libraries into the app bundle we distribute). AFAICT
# this is a known issue (https://github.com/orgs/Homebrew/discussions/2823). So now we are trying installing
# Qt6 via MacPorts.
#
# In the expectation that we might well chop and change between what we install via which package manager, we
# aim to support both below and to make it relatively easy to change which one is used to install which
# packages.
#
# Both package managers handle dependencies, so we could make our list of what to install very minimal (eg
# installing Xalan-C will cause Xerces-C to be installed too, as the former depends on the latter). However, I
# think it's clearer to explicitly list all the _direct_ dependencies (eg we do make calls directly into
# Xerces, so we should list it as an explicit dependency).

#
# If we try to install a Homebrew package that is already installed, we'll get a warning. This isn't
# horrendous, but it looks a bit bad on the GitHub automated builds (because a lot of things are already
# installed by the time this script runs). As explained at
# https://apple.stackexchange.com/questions/284379/with-homebrew-how-to-check-if-a-software-package-is-installed,
# the simplest (albeit perhaps not the most elegant) way to check whether a package is already installed is
# to run `brew list`, throw away the output, and look at the return code, which will be 0 if the package is
# already installed and 1 if it is not. In the shell, we can use the magic of short-circuit evaluation
# (https://en.wikipedia.org/wiki/Short-circuit_evaluation) to, at a small legibility cost, do the whole
# check-and-install, in a single line. But in Python, it's easier to do it in two steps.
